Excerpt from Design of a 20000 K. W. Steam Turbo-Generator Station: A Thesis
The following thesis is a consideration of'the mechanical and electrical features involved in.the design of a large, modern, central station. The work is not intended* to be general for a specific case has been assumed. Further, the time and scope of the work does not permit of original designs of apparatus, nor would it be advisable to do so; but, rather, directs the attention toward analyzing possible existing conditions, decid ing upon best arrangements, etc. To secure prompt and reliable execution of the require ments, and then selecting the proper apparatus from the numerous standard makes on the market.
